This Rotisserie Chicken Stuffing Casserole is the ultimate comfort food made easy. Tender rotisserie chicken, savory stuffing, creamy sauce, and colorful vegetables come together in one cozy, oven-baked dish that’s perfect for busy weeknights, potlucks, or family dinners.
Ingredients
-
3 cups shredded rotisserie chicken
-
1 (6 oz) box stuffing mix
-
1 can (10.5 oz) condensed cream of chicken soup
-
1 cup chicken broth
-
½ cup sour cream
-
½ cup milk
-
1½ cups frozen mixed vegetables (peas, carrots, corn)
-
½ teaspoon dried thyme
-
½ teaspoon dried sage
-
½ teaspoon salt (or to taste)
-
¼ teaspoon black pepper
-
¼ cup butter, melted
-
1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)
Instructions
-
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
-
In a large bowl, combine shredded rotisserie chicken, stuffing mix, cream of chicken soup, chicken broth, sour cream, and milk. Stir until well mixed.
-
Gently fold in frozen vegetables, thyme, sage, salt, and pepper until evenly distributed.
-
Spread the mixture evenly into the prepared baking dish.
-
Drizzle melted butter over the top to help create a golden, crispy finish.
-
Bake uncovered for 30–35 minutes, until heated through and lightly browned on top.
-
Let rest for 5 minutes before serving. Garnish with parsley if desired.
Notes
You can assemble this casserole up to 24 hours ahead and refrigerate before baking.
For a crispier top, broil for 1–2 minutes at the end (watch closely).
Swap frozen veggies for fresh or canned if needed—just drain well.
Leftovers reheat beautifully and taste even better the next day.
